King’s Bounty: Warriors of the North vs V Rising: which should you buy?

Both titles cater to different gamer profiles, so the choice hinges on hardware, gameplay style, and desired play length. King’s Bounty: Warriors of the North is a classic single‑player adventure/RPG/strategy hybrid that runs on very modest PCs – it will work on Windows XP with a 2.6 GHz CPU, 1 GB RAM and a 128 MB graphics card. Its average playtime is about 5 hours, making it a quick, story‑driven experience for players with older or low‑end rigs. V Rising, by contrast, is a modern action‑adventure MMO that demands a 64‑bit Windows 10 system, at least a mid‑range i5‑6600/AMD Ryzen 5 1500X, 12 GB RAM and a dedicated GPU (GTX 750 Ti or better). It offers both solo and extensive multiplayer/co‑op modes and runs longer (≈7 hours) with ongoing online content. If you have a recent PC and enjoy multiplayer vampiric combat, V Rising is the better fit; if you prefer a low‑spec, single‑player strategy adventure, King’s Bounty is the safer pick. Both share a community rating of 3.7 / 5, so personal hardware and genre preference are the decisive factors.
